Sharpless 2-216

Sharpless 2-216 (Sh2-216) is a large, ancient planetary nebula located in the constellation Perseus. At an estimated distance of roughly 420 light-years, it is among the nearest known planetary nebulae to Earth. Sharpless 2-290

Sharpless 2-290 (also cataloged as Abell 31) is a planetary nebula located in the constellation Cancer at an approximate distance of 2,000 light-years from Earth. Estimated to be around 20,000 years old, it is one of the largest and oldest known planetary nebulae, with an asymmetrical shell measuring approximately 4 light-years across.
